KIN Releases Their Self-Title EP

Posted by dmusique on 22.12.2010 in KIN
Manitoba-based folk-pop trio KIN will release its much anticipated debut EP on Tuesday, December 28th. Produced by veteran Winnipeg sound engineer Norman Dugas, the self-titled album’s five tracks feature winsome harmonies and carefully crafted lyrics. The album’s first single, Malgré tout, has received substantial play on local and Quebec radio stations. Also included is the popular “Why Don’t You Call”.
KIN’s lead vocalist Danielle Burke and brothers Ivan and Eric charm French and English audiences alike with their smart songwriting and spectacular musical precision. The band recently recorded a CBC Canada Live concert with Juno-award winners Chic Gamine, and has played numerous times at Festival du Voyageur.
